Description

2-Pentanone, 3-Mercapto-3-Methyl- (7Ci,9Ci) CAS NO 89534-21-4 is a specialized organosulfur compound featuring a ketone and a thiol functional group on the same carbon chain. This unique bifunctional structure makes it a valuable intermediate for synthesizing complex molecules, particularly in the pharmaceutical and agrochemical sectors. It is primarily sought by R&D chemists and process development scientists for applications requiring the introduction of a thiol-protected ketone moiety or for creating heterocyclic compounds.

Basic Information

Product Name 2-Pentanone, 3-Mercapto-3-Methyl- (7Ci,9Ci)
CAS No. 89534-21-4
Molecular Formula C6H12OS
Molecular Weight 132.22 g/mol
Synonyms 3-Methyl-3-mercapto-2-pentanone; 3-Mercapto-3-methylpentan-2-one; 3-Methyl-3-sulfanylpentan-2-one; 3-Methyl-3-thiopentan-2-one; 3-Methyl-3-mercaptopentan-2-one; 3-Methyl-3-thiol-2-pentanone; 89534-21-4

Storage

Preserve in a tightly closed container, protected from light. Store under an inert atmosphere (e.g., nitrogen or argon) in a cool, dry, and well-ventilated area. Recommended storage temperature is 2-8°C to minimize oxidation and degradation. Keep away from strong oxidizing agents and heat sources.
